Swedish and Igbo ISO Language Codes

ISO language codes are designed to represent most of the languages in the world. Swedish and Igbo ISO language codes consists of ISO 639 1, ISO 639 2, ISO 639 3 codes. ISO 639 1 is the two letter code, while ISO 639 2 and ISO 639 3 are three letter codes.

    Swedish ISO Codes:
  • ISO 639 1 code: sv
  • ISO 639 2/T code: swe
  • ISO 639 2/B code: swe
  • ISO 639 3 code: swe
    Igbo ISO Codes:
  • ISO 639 1 code: ig
  • ISO 639 2/T code: ibo
  • ISO 639 2/B code: ibo
  • ISO 639 3 code: ibo

Swedish vs Igbo Glottocodes

You will find Swedish vs Igbo glottocodes under the Swedish and Igbo language codes. Swedish glottocode is swed1254 and Igbo glottocode is nucl1417. Along with Swedish and Igbo language codes, you can also check how many people speak these languages on Swedish vs Igbo.
